Corisande wants to trust but finds it hard to do so, tending to think the worst about a situation. With people it is worse, as her lack of trust even after an extended period of time can bring issues to the surface. Closed off, Corisande can become emotionally distant when confronted or even aggressive if the circumstance causes her to feel threatened. Once she is sure of something, no matter how wrong it may be, it is hard for her to let it go: especially informationly. This ill-informed nature leads her to act foolishly or even rashly, only added to future skepticism. As negative as her mental capacity can be Corisande is very practical and responsible about things, understanding personal views aside she is lacking in many ways and must deal with the situation in front of her instead of focusing on her inner thoughts. She places a lot of thought into her future and how she will get by day to day so her opinions matter little when it comes to the larger picture: which is survival. Frugality is required as well as keeping a level head for these things. She is careful and wary, a woman who keeps her mouth shut. When it comes to situations or people she might draw the wrong conclusions but that doesn't mean she isn't noticing things. Corisande is very observant to things that are going on around her in the world. Richard was a farmer and Jane was a seamstress. Corisande had a good childhood, learning how to sew from her mother, that was until she was sixteen years old. Corisande, as well as many in their village (including her parents), all came down with influenza that winter. It was a hard several months. Many recovered, including Corisande. Her parents did not and died within three days of each other. They were married for eight years before the man passed away, a nice way of putting it. He was run over one morning by a wagon as he was passed out in a drunken stupor on the side of the road and the driver did not see him. Having no children, and no property, and their house rented from the local Minister, Corisande did what she could to stay afloat for a time. The pay was not much but it provided her with a roof over her head, food in her stomach, an exit from the home she had been forced to live in, and some sort of stability. Since moving into to Elmswood, Corisande has to play it safe as the Lady Daventry is volatile against any who do not live up to her standards. She spends many late hours sewing, trying to keep up the maddening pace, but Corisande keeps loosing time. Hours and hours, and she cannot figure out why.
